Ryan Phelan Reset: Veteran Email Marketer Departs CEO Post At RPE Origin


Ryan Phelan, the email expert and educator, has stepped down as CEO of RPE Origin, a digital agency. 

“After nearly eight years, I’ve stepped away from my role as CEO of RPE Origin to begin new chapter,” Phelan wrote on LinkedIn. 

The circumstances were not known at deadline. The departure comes two years after Phelan  became CEO.

Phelan succeeded John Caldwell, who founded Red Pill Email in 2004. In 2020, Caldwell  joined forces with Phelan and his agency, Origin Email, to create RPE Origin in 2020. Caldwell has since died. 

Earlier in his career, Phelan worked at Acxiom, Responsys, Sears & Kmart, BlueHornet and infoUSA. He also ran marketing for Adestra’s U.S. business, and in that capacity put out a series of insightful surveys and papers.

“Over the years, I worked closely with enterprise clients navigating data fragmentation, platform sprawl, and increasing pressure to prove outcomes that actually move the business, not vanity metrics, he wrote, describing his career. “All in the powerful email channel.” 

And now?

“I’m taking a short reset, then looking ahead,” Phelan wrote on LinkedIn. “I’m excited by opportunities where strategy, data infrastructure, and execution come together, where AI augments decision-making instead of replacing it, where accountability matters as much as ambition, and where what I’ve learned over the years can benefit marketers.” 

Phelan has often been featured as an expert in Email Insider. That will continue.
